Record heatwaves across Western Europe are straining infrastructure and driving up energy costs for businesses and households [1, 2].
These weather patterns matter because they create a compounding economic shock. The intersection of rising cooling costs, increased wildfire risks, and higher insurance premiums is fueling inflation and hindering overall economic growth [1, 2].
Germany and the United Kingdom have been notably affected by the extreme temperatures this summer [1, 2]. The heat is pushing energy prices higher as demand for cooling spikes, a trend that puts additional pressure on power grids already struggling with the load.
Beyond immediate energy bills, the heatwaves are creating secondary financial burdens. Increased wildfire risks have led to a rise in insurance premiums for property owners [1, 2]. These costs act as a hidden tax on the economy, reducing the disposable income of households, and increasing overhead for businesses.
Economists said that these environmental pressures are contributing to a broader trend of slowing growth. When infrastructure is strained and operational costs rise due to climate-driven weather, productivity often drops [1, 2].
The current situation reflects a growing pattern where hot summers are becoming a recurring and expensive challenge for the region [2]. The strain on Western European systems suggests that current infrastructure may be insufficient for the frequency of these record-breaking events.

The economic impact of the 2026 heatwaves demonstrates that climate change is no longer just an environmental issue but a systemic financial risk. By simultaneously increasing energy costs and insurance premiums while slowing GDP growth, extreme weather is creating a 'climate inflation' effect that complicates monetary policy and infrastructure planning in Western Europe.
